5 Defender-Inspired SUVs Coming To India Soon

Defender lookalike SUVs in India

Rugged, boxy SUVs are slowly making a comeback in the global car market. While many modern SUVs are moving towards sleeker and more aerodynamic designs, some manufacturers are still embracing the classic upright styling made famous by off-road icons.

In India, the Land Rover Defender remains one of the most recognizable SUVs with this design language. Now, several upcoming models from different brands are adopting a similar rugged approach. Here are five Defender-inspired SUVs that could launch in India in the near future.

Jetour T2

The Jetour T2 is expected to be among the first new rugged SUVs to arrive in India. The model could be introduced through the partnership between JSW and Chinese automaker Chery as part of their plans to enter the Indian market.

The SUV features a very boxy exterior with an upright bonnet, chunky bumpers and squared-off LED headlamps. Internationally, the Jetour T2 is offered with a plug-in hybrid powertrain that combines a 1.5-litre turbo petrol engine with an electric motor.

This setup is expected to deliver an electric-only driving range of close to 100 km. In terms of size, the SUV is slightly larger than many mid-size SUVs sold in India today.

Chery iCar V23

Another rugged SUV that could arrive through the same partnership is the iCar V23. This model follows a similar boxy design theme with round headlamps, upright proportions and a strong off-road-inspired stance.

The iCar V23 is a fully electric SUV and has already been spotted testing in India. Globally, it is offered with battery packs of around 59.93 kWh and 81.76 kWh. The smaller battery version comes with rear-wheel drive, while the larger battery variant offers an all-wheel-drive setup.

The cabin is expected to feature a large touchscreen infotainment system, premium materials and modern driver assistance technology.

Renault Bridger

Renault has also previewed a new compact SUV concept called the Bridger. Unlike many other compact SUVs, this model adopts a more rugged and practical design with a boxy silhouette.

The Bridger is expected to be a sub-four-metre SUV developed specifically for markets like India. The concept shown earlier features a tailgate-mounted spare wheel, giving it a strong off-road-inspired look.

Multiple powertrain options are expected including petrol, turbo petrol, hybrid and even electric variants.

Nissan Version Of The Bridger

Nissan is also expected to launch its own version of the Bridger after Renault introduces the model. Both vehicles are likely to share the same platform and mechanical components.

However, Nissan’s version could feature a slightly different exterior design. Reports suggest that the styling could take inspiration from larger Nissan SUVs such as the Patrol.

Mahindra Vision S

Mahindra Vision S Render

Mahindra has been developing several new SUVs based on its next-generation architecture. One of the concepts previewed earlier is the Vision S.

The production version of this SUV has already been spotted testing on Indian roads. It features a muscular and boxy exterior design with strong character lines and a spare wheel mounted on the tailgate.

The model is expected to be positioned in the sub-four-metre segment and could be offered with both petrol and diesel engine options when it launches in the coming years.
